Understanding the OS FS-48 Surpass

The OS FS-48 Surpass is a popular four-stroke glow ignition engine renowned for its compact size and capable performance. As part of OS Engines' renowned "Surpass" line, it benefits from advanced engineering and a reputation for quality. Four-stroke engines, in general, offer a more authentic engine sound, better fuel efficiency, and a wider torque band compared to their two-stroke counterparts. The FS-48 Surpass, with its 0.48 cubic inch displacement, is often considered a sweet spot for many sport and scale models, offering a good balance of power and weight.

Performance and Power Output

When we talk about a "good runner," consistent and adequate power is paramount. The OS FS-48 Surpass is generally praised for delivering a strong performance for its displacement. While specific figures can vary depending on fuel, propeller choice, and tuning, users often report that the FS-48 Surpass can comfortably swing propellers in the 11x6 to 12x6 range. Some enthusiasts have even reported success with slightly larger props like a 12x8 or even a 13x6 in certain applications, albeit with potentially reduced top-end RPM.

A key indicator of a good runner is its ability to achieve and maintain a consistent RPM range. For the FS-48 Surpass, achieving around 9,000 to 10,000 RPM with a well-matched propeller on a standard 10% nitro fuel is often considered excellent performance. This level of power is typically sufficient for a wide array of popular RC aircraft, including trainers, sport planes, and some scale models, providing a satisfying flying experience.

Potential Issues: Detonation and Tuning

One of the most critical aspects of engine health and performance is avoiding detonation. In four-stroke engines, detonation is an uncontrolled ignition of the fuel-air mixture within the cylinder. It can manifest as an intermittent "crack" or "whacking" sound, particularly at higher throttle settings. If you're experiencing such a sound with your FS-48 Surpass, it's a clear sign that the engine is running too lean. A lean mixture causes the fuel-air mixture to burn too quickly and at a higher temperature, leading to excessive pressure and the characteristic detonation sound. This condition can lead to overheating, potential damage to engine components, and even the loosening of the propeller, which is a serious safety concern.

Addressing detonation is straightforward: richen the high-speed needle valve. By increasing the fuel flow, you help to cool the combustion chamber and slow down the burn rate, thus eliminating the detonation. It's crucial to make small adjustments and observe the engine's response. Over-richening can lead to poor performance and fouling of the glow plug, so finding the optimal balance is key.

Tuning a four-stroke engine is an art, and the FS-48 Surpass is no exception. While generally considered well-behaved, it requires careful adjustment of both the low-speed and high-speed needles to achieve optimal performance across the entire throttle range. A properly tuned engine will transition smoothly from idle to full throttle without hesitation or sputtering, and it will maintain a stable idle speed.

Propeller Selection: Finding the Sweet Spot

The choice of propeller is arguably the most significant factor in an engine's perceived performance. As mentioned, the 11x6 to 12x6 range is often cited as ideal for the OS FS-48 Surpass. However, the specific aircraft you intend to power plays a crucial role.

For lighter sport models or trainers that don't require extreme speed, a larger diameter and lower pitch propeller, like a 12x6, can provide excellent thrust and a satisfying flying experience. For aircraft that benefit from higher speeds or have a more streamlined design, a slightly smaller pitch, such as a 12x7 or 11x7, might be considered. However, it's always advisable to start with the manufacturer's recommendations or widely accepted prop sizes for the engine and then experiment cautiously.

Consider the following comparison for propeller selection:

Propeller SizeTypical ApplicationExpected Performance Characteristics
11x6Sport flyers, trainers, models requiring good climbGood all-around performance, balanced thrust and speed
12x6Scale models, trainers, models benefiting from more thrustStronger static thrust, good for takeoff and climb, slightly lower top speed
11x7Faster sport models, models with higher wing loadingHigher top speed, potentially slightly less static thrust
12x7High-performance sport models, models requiring a balance of speed and thrustGood compromise between speed and thrust, requires careful tuning

Always remember that prop selection is an iterative process. Start with a recommended size, monitor engine performance (temperature, sound, RPM), and adjust as needed. A good optical tachometer is invaluable for this process.

The Importance of an Optical Tachometer

To truly gauge the performance of your OS FS-48 Surpass and ensure it's running optimally, an optical tachometer is an indispensable tool. While some might rely on the sound of the engine, an optical tachometer provides precise RPM readings. This data is crucial for fine-tuning the engine, especially the high-speed needle. Knowing the exact RPM allows you to confirm if you're within the engine's optimal operating range and to detect potential issues like detonation more accurately.

Historically, devices like the Futaba "TachoTimer" were popular. In today's market, the Fromeco TNC tachometer is often cited as a top-tier option, though its price point can be a consideration for some modellers. Regardless of the specific model, investing in a reliable optical tachometer will significantly improve your engine tuning capabilities and overall flying experience.

Frequently Asked Questions (FAQ)

What is the best propeller for the OS FS-48 Surpass?
A 12x6 propeller is often considered a good starting point for balanced performance. However, 11x6, 11x7, or 12x7 can also be suitable depending on the aircraft and desired flight characteristics.
What causes a "click" sound in my FS-48 Surpass at high throttle?
This sound is likely detonation, caused by a too-lean fuel mixture. You should richen the high-speed needle valve immediately to prevent potential engine damage.
What type of fuel should I use with the FS-48 Surpass?
A standard 10% nitro fuel with 17-20% oil content is generally recommended for four-stroke engines like the FS-48 Surpass. Always check the manufacturer's specific recommendations.
How do I check the actual RPM of my engine?
Using an optical tachometer is the most accurate way to measure your engine's RPM. This allows for precise tuning.
Is the FS-48 Surpass suitable for scale models?
Yes, the FS-48 Surpass is well-suited for many sport and scale models due to its good power-to-weight ratio and authentic four-stroke sound.
